AISI appoints VP of auto program

The American Iron and Steel Institute (AISI) has named Christopher Kristock as vice president of the automotive program for AISI. In this position, he is responsible for leadership of AISI’s Automotive Applications Council, a group of AISI member steel producers focused on automotive innovation, education, and technology transfer activities.

Since 2014, Kristock has held several positions of responsibility at an automotive metal processor, including vice president of quality and technology. Previously, he served as vice president quality and product development at Severstal North America and was co-chairman of its international global technology system.
